The Role of Regulation and Technology in Ontario’s Betting Scene

Ontario’s regulatory framework is structured around the Alcohol and Gaming Commission of Ontario (AGCO), combined with the iGaming Ontario body that manages marketplace licensing. These entities ensure that operators meet strict standards emphasizing fairness, transparency, and security. For users, this means your deposits and winnings are protected, and all games comply with set RTP (Return to Player) percentages, often hovering around 95%–97% depending on the sport and bet type.

Technologically, most platforms leverage SSL encryption, biometric logins, and multi-factor authentication to keep accounts secure. Payment methods are also diverse, with popular options like Interac e-Transfers, Visa, and Mastercard dominating the scene. The familiarity of these choices reduces friction and adds confidence for those new to online betting.

Common Missteps to Avoid When Starting Out

One of the biggest hurdles for beginners is jumping in without a clear strategy. It might be tempting to bet on your favorite team repeatedly or chase losses, but these habits often lead to frustration. Instead, it helps to start small and focus on understanding bet types—moneyline, point spreads, and over/under bets, for instance—before scaling up.

Here are a few quick tips:

  • Always read the terms and conditions related to bonuses or promotions.
  • Keep track of your betting history to avoid overspending.
  • Use tools like betting calculators to understand potential returns.
  • Set a budget and stick to it rigorously.
  • Take breaks if you notice emotions influencing your decisions.

Exploring Popular Sports and Markets in Ontario

Ontario’s sports betting market is as diverse as its population. Hockey remains a favorite, unsurprisingly, with NHL games attracting substantial wagering volume. Other sports such as basketball, football, and baseball also command attention, while niche markets like darts or esports appeal to more adventurous bettors.

Live betting has gained significant traction here, allowing players to wager on games as they happen. This dynamic form of betting adds excitement but requires quick thinking and a good grasp of the sport’s nuances. Providers often offer detailed stats and real-time updates to help bettors make informed decisions.

Balancing Fun and Responsibility in the Betting World

While the accessibility of Ontario’s sports betting is undoubtedly a positive, it’s important not to overlook the responsibility that comes with it. Gambling should remain an enjoyable pastime, not a source of stress or financial strain. Many platforms include options for self-exclusion and deposit limits, tools that encourage mindful betting habits.

It’s worth asking yourself: am I betting for entertainment or trying to fix financial issues? Keeping this distinction clear helps maintain a healthy relationship with the activity. Remember, the goal is to enhance the thrill of watching sports, not to rely on it as a source of income.
